For 150 € you get a DC TIG welder that also welds stick. That is unbeatable guys!
For those who complain about the missing AC welding for aluminum:
1. It would require the whole electronics that produce AC welding current and the different forms of pulses. It would be at a higher cost and it would be a higher weight.
2. How many times do you ACTUALLY need to weld in aluminum?
If you have a minimum of stuff to be TIG welded and/or want to learn how to weld ..buy it.

Scratch start is the worst method. Lift Tig is present in most low price equipment: you touch slightly with tungsten's tip and it happens. HF (high frequency) start method is for higher price gear.
Surely this TIG is a LiftTig machine.
